With the development of society and economy, energy demand is increasing.Energy structure based on fossil energy can not satisfy the needs of sustainabledevelopment any more. Humanity face serious energy shortage and environmentalissues of burning fossil fuels. Based on this; application of solar energy technologybecomes research focus. However, the solar energy has the special characteristicsthat solar light energy density is low, intermittent and spatial distribution is changing.So this paper studies on solar tracking technology. Solar tracking system can reducethe angle between sun incident light and incidence of solar cell arrays. It canimprove the utilization of solar radiation and reduce the cost of power generationsystem.Firstly, the development of solar tracker and the principle of solar tracking in theworld are introduced. This paper has proposed the tracking strategy composed of thesolar trajectory and optical tracking. It can achieve automatic tracking with a widerange of sun.Secondly, elevation-azimuth angle tracking device is designed. The componentsof the selection and design of the hardware are completed using the control strategyaccording to the solar tracking system.Thirdly, according to the requirements of the design, the software of the systemis completed in this FPGA platform. Solar trajectory algorithm achieving, opticaltracking of image processing and the step motor driving are included.Finally, the hardware and software experiments show that the proposed controlmethod, the design of the solar tracking controller's hardware and software arepracticable. The system has lots of advantages such as simple structure, runningsmoothly and high tracking precision.
